1.創建一個有關本身學號的目錄java
2.在當前文件下編譯一個帶包Hello.java文件函數
3.代碼內容3d
package hjw; import java.util.Scanner; public class Hello{ public static void main(String[] args){ System.out.println("Input your first name, please:"); Scanner s = new Scanner(System.in); String name = s.next(); System.out.println("Hello " + name + " 20165329!"); } }
4.編譯運行截圖
調試
1.在IDEA中從新建立一個HelloJDB的項目code
2.輸入以下代碼blog
public class HelloJDB { public static void main(String[] args) { int i = 5; int j = 6; int sum = add(i, j); System.out.println(sum); sum = 0; for(i=0; i< 100; i++) sum += i; System.out.println(sum); } public static int add(int augend, int addend){ int sum = augend + addend; return sum; } }
3.點擊run運行
ci
4.調試
首先設置一個斷點
開發
單步執行
編譯
條件斷點
class
臨時斷點
1.打開IDEA建立一個fibonacci項目
2.輸入以下代碼
/** *Created by hjw on 2018/4/1. */ import java.util.Scanner; public class fibonacci { public static void main(String[] args) { System.out.println("請輸入你想要求幾個數"); Scanner reader=new Scanner(System.in); int i = reader.nextInt(); int a=1,b=0,c=0,sum=0; if(i<1) { System.out.println("非法狀況,輸入個數小於1"); } else { for(int n=1;n<=i;n++) { sum = a + b; c = b; b = a; a = sum; System.out.println(sum); } } System.out.println("Fibonacci函數值爲"+sum+" 取值個數爲"+i); } }
3.運行結果
正常
異常
邊界